Output 2c80b2089739db8974bd0182a5ec48b913dceae021368f277ba1d4ba92a75ffb:2

value
26700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d243c449a3b5859f0a60d021af3584c2eb0e229c OP_EQUAL
address
3Lro1Lvm6TFyhZHktANGzHSJV1bUN1BYW7
transaction
2c80b2089739db8974bd0182a5ec48b913dceae021368f277ba1d4ba92a75ffb
confirmations
458282
spent
true